Job Description

Hamilton Telecommunications is seeking a full-time Assistant Accounting Manager for the corporate office in Aurora, NE. This role is ideal for an accounting professional who wants to expand technical skills, gain broad hands-on experience, and grow into greater responsibility. This position will support billing, reconciliations, compliance, and month-end processes while working closely with leadership in a collaborative environment.
Key responsibilities include:
Support monthly billing processes across multiple service lines and ensure accuracy. Reconcile billing systems, bank activity, and general ledger accounts; investigate discrepancies. Review revenue, taxes, and related transactions for compliance and accuracy. Assist with accounts payable, cash application, and vendor/customer inquiry resolution. Contribute to month-end and year-end close activities and related reporting. Prepare and support compliance filings, including tax and 1099 reporting. Help improve accounting procedures, internal controls, and process efficiency.
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in Accounting or Business Administration preferred; equivalent experience considered. Strong Excel, analytical, reconciliation, and organizational skills. Ability to manage multiple priorities, meet deadlines, and communicate effectively. Detail-oriented with a commitment to accuracy and continuous improvement.
Why Join Hamilton:
Company-paid benefits for full-time employees. Hands-on experience with opportunities to grow your accounting career. A stable, team-oriented company that supports long-term development. Hamilton Telecommunications is a diversified communications and technology service provider based in Aurora, NE. Founded in 1901, Hamilton Telecommunications encompasses nine primary company divisions that allow Hamilton to operate on a local, regional and national basis.
